The Garment District is a neighborhood in Manhattan located between Fifth and Ninth Avenues, stretching from 34th to 42nd Street. It is has been well-known since the early 20th century as the fashion center of NYC fashion, and could be considered the foremost center of fashion design and manufacturing in the United States. The Garment Center is also known for its 'secret' sales shows and bargains. Shops and showrooms are available where as little as $10-15 can buy you a bargain. Madison Square Garden- Known as "The Garden" to New Yorkers, Madison Square Garden is New York's biggest entertainment arena, sitting atop historic Penn Station. MSG is home to numerous concerts, sporting events and the circus every year. It is the home arena of the New York Knicks and New York Rangers and often called "The World's Most Famous Arena."
